Baixe o app para aproveitar ainda mais
Prévia do material em texto
29/04/2016 Aluno: CÍCERO MEDEIROS DE OLIVEIRA JÚNIOR • http://estacio.webaula.com.br/salaframe.asp?curso=2139&turma=467522&topico=818005 1/3 1a Questão (Ref.: 201407091406) Fórum de Dúvidas (0) Saiba (0) Seja um programa em java com o seguinte código: public class PrimeiroPrograma { public static void main (String args[]) { System.out.println("Bem vindo ao Mundo Java"); } } Marque a única alternativa CORRETA: O arquivo pode ser salvo como primeiroprograma.java, pois o java não faz diferença entre letras maiúscula e minúscula. O arquivo deve ser salvo como PrimeiroPrograma.java, pois o java faz diferença entre letras maiúscula e minúscula. O arquivo pode ser salvo com qualquer nome desde que tenha a extensão .java, indicando que é um código fonte em java. O arquivo deve ser salvo como ProgramaPrincipal.java, pois este possui o método main (String arg []) que é o método principal do java. O arquivo pode ser salvo com qualquer nome, pois o compilador entenderá que é um programa em java. Gabarito Comentado 2a Questão (Ref.: 201407046625) Fórum de Dúvidas (0) Saiba (0) No âmbito da linguagem Java, considere: I. Edição é a criação do programa, que também é chamado de código Bytecode. II. Compilação é a geração de um código intermediário chamado fonte, que é um código independente de plataforma. III. Na interpretação, a máquina virtual Java ou JVM analisa e executa cada instrução do código Bytecode. IV. Na linguagem Java a interpretação ocorre apenas uma vez e a compilação ocorre a cada vez que o programa é executado. Está correto o que consta em I, II, III e IV IV, somente III e IV, somente III, somente II e IV, somente 3a Questão (Ref.: 201407046624) Fórum de Dúvidas (0) Saiba (0) A tecnologia Java é, basicamente, dividida em: JSE, JEEP e JME JSE, JEE e JPE JSE, JDE e JPE 29/04/2016 Aluno: CÍCERO MEDEIROS DE OLIVEIRA JÚNIOR • http://estacio.webaula.com.br/salaframe.asp?curso=2139&turma=467522&topico=818005 2/3 JSE, JDE e JME JSE, JEE e JME 4a Questão (Ref.: 201407045007) Fórum de Dúvidas (0) Saiba (0) De acordo com o texto abaixo, qual a alternativa correta? (Fonte: adaptado IBM) "é um programa que carrega e executa os aplica�vos Java, convertendo os bytecodes em código executável de máquina." JDK JRE JVM garbage collector JSR Gabarito Comentado 5a Questão (Ref.: 201407044454) Fórum de Dúvidas (0) Saiba (0) A tecnologia Java implementa um serviço conhecido como Garbage Collector Coletor de Lixo. Sua função é: Eliminar os objetos que não estão sendo usados se estiver com pouco espaço na memória. Determinar quando uma classe deve ser abstrata. Possibilitar a criação de herança entre as classes. Detectar os Hot Spots das aplicações. Permitir a instanciação do objeto na memória. Gabarito Comentado 6a Questão (Ref.: 201407590423) Fórum de Dúvidas (0) Saiba (0) É muito importante para trabalharmos com a programação java, que saibamos como o mesmo funciona, quais suas partes e a relação entre elas. Em relação ao funcionamento podemos afirmar que o mesmo acontece na seguinte ordem: Editor gera o .java, Compilador gera o .class, Carregador gera o bytecodes, Verificador gera o código binário e por fim o Interpretador interpreta o binário. Editor gera o .class, Compilador gera o .Java, Carregador gera o código binário, Verificador verifica o binário e por fim o Interpretador interpreta o binário. Editor gera o .java, Compilador gera o .class, Carregador gera o bytecodes, Verificador verifica o bytecodes e por fim o Interpretador interpreta os bytecodes. Editor gera o .java, Compilador gera o .class, Carregador gera o código binário, Verificador verifica o binário e por fim o Interpretador interpreta o binário. Editor gera o .class, Compilador gera o .Java, Carregador gera o bytecodes, Verificador verifica o bytecodes e por fim o Interpretador interpreta os bytecodes. 29/04/2016 Aluno: CÍCERO MEDEIROS DE OLIVEIRA JÚNIOR • http://estacio.webaula.com.br/salaframe.asp?curso=2139&turma=467522&topico=818005 3/3 Gabarito Comentado
Compartilhar